EBlock is an online vehicle auction where vehicles are bought and sold in 60 seconds. Our technology gives automotive dealers the opportunity to inspect and sell vehicles in a live online auction from their own dealership. EBlock currently hosts two types of auctions: In the first, dealers are able to launch and load auctions at the time of vehicle appraisal. The second enables dealers to sell fresh trades or aged inventory. At EBlock, we are constantly innovating to adapt to today’s automotive dealer’s needs. Role Summary

The Inspector Lead oversees the assigned regions by working closely with inspectors with job training, setting expectations, and monitoring inspections to ensure that they meet company standards. They also work closely with the Regional Inspection Manager and National Inspection Manager with ensuring the inspection standards for quality and efficiency are followed. Travel to do ride alongs with the inspectors in your region and meetings will be required.


What You Will Do


  • Manage the day to day work-load and scheduling of the inspectors in the region
  • Ensure inspection processes and procedures are being followed to company standards
  • Complete training of new hires and provide ongoing training for your team
  • Approve bonuses, time cards and PTO requests.
  • Responsible for assisting with hiring, disciplinary actions and termination
  • Meet with your team members regularly to reinforce good practices and verify the quality of their work
  • Host weekly virtual team meetings to review achievements, concerns and procedural updates
  • Audit all condition reports completed by new hires for 30 days and spot check of all other inspectors
  • Conduct inspections of vehicles to detect damage, missing parts, and mechanical problems; prepare and submit reports of vehicle
  • Assist the inspection management team with the creation and maintenance of training documentation
  • Follow all applicable safety and health related procedures
  • Perform other job-related duties as directed by supervisor
